Description

Gemma Jericho is an overworked New York doctor with a handful of a teenaged daughter and a meddlesome mother. So when her mother receives a letter of a mysterious inheritance in Tuscany, Gemma welcomes the change, and the three leave for Italy. She hopes that a change of scenery will solve her problems with her daughter and her mother. Then as cultures clash, gossip soars, and intrigue unfolds, Gemma is caught up in the most disturbing-and delicious-trouble she's ever had.
